About James Hart

James Hart is a Corporate Counsel with a diverse legal background in corporate and transactional law. He has worked at various firms and companies, including Koley Jessen P.C., L.L.O., Polsinelli, and Stepan Company, and holds degrees in Finance and Banking, as well as a Juris Doctor from Notre Dame Law School.

Work at Stepan Company

James Hart currently serves as Corporate Counsel at Stepan Company, a position he has held since 2023. His role involves focusing on transactions, securities, commercial contracts, and general corporate matters. He operates on-site in Northbrook, Illinois, contributing his legal expertise to the company's operations.

Previous Legal Experience

Prior to joining Stepan Company, James Hart worked as an Associate Attorney at Polsinelli from 2019 to 2023, where he gained experience in various legal matters. He also served as Associate Claims Counsel at Fidelity National Title for seven months in 2016, and as an Associate Attorney at Koley Jessen P.C., L.L.O. from 2017 to 2019. His diverse legal background encompasses both corporate and transactional law.

Education and Expertise

James Hart holds a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) in Finance and Banking, graduating Cum Laude from the University of Missouri-Columbia in 2011. He furthered his education at Notre Dame Law School, earning a Juris Doctor degree Cum Laude in 2016. Additionally, he obtained a Master of Business Administration (M.B.A.) with a concentration in Corporate Finance from the University of Notre Dame - Mendoza College of Business in 2016.
